A cactus (plural cacti, cactuses, or less commonly, cactus) is a member of the plant family Cactaceae, a family comprising about 127 genera with some 1750 known species of the order Caryophyllales. The word "cactus" derives, through Latin, from the Ancient Greek κάκτος, kaktos, a name originally used by Theophrastus for a spiny plant whose identity is now not certain. Nopales pronounced [noh-POH-lays] are native to Mexico, where the nopalli (nahuatl word for nopales) have been favored, eaten and grown as a vegetable since before the Spanish arrived.
